They also highlight how threat agents aren’t just virtual anymore. With the rise of interconnected devices and smart systems, cyber and physical vulnerabilities often overlap, creating new risks that demand constant awareness.
And while you’ve likely heard the classic tips—use strong passwords, enable multi-factor authentication, and keep your systems updated—Robert and Dr. Bolman stress one overlooked but critical best practice:
👉 Be mindful of what you share on social media. Posting vacation pictures in real time or broadcasting your location makes it easier for threat agents to combine digital footprints with physical opportunities. Sometimes, safety starts with silence. Check out the episode in full here -
